Day after fatal South Korea plane crash, another Jeju Air flight faces landing gear issues

A Jeju Air Boeing 737-800 returned to Seoul's Gimpo International Airport due to landing gear issues, following a similar model's fatal crash the previous day....

South Korea plane crash: 177 passengers out of 181 confirmed dead, suspended President Yoon sends condolences

As many as 177 passengers out of 181 have been confirmed dead after a Jeju Air Plane veered off the runway and collided with a fence in South Korea's Muan City...
